Survival from breast cancer in women with a BRCA2 mutation by treatment.

Published in: British journal of cancer (2021)
For women with breast cancer and a germline BRCA2 mutation, positive ER status does not predict superior survival. Oophorectomy is associated with a reduced risk of death from breast cancer and should be considered in the treatment plan.
